Transaction 81dfb44d1e4b7a3a2da86888268e0459fa5179c725c94e880fdae0c722054a89
1 Input
1 Output
-
81dfb44d1e4b7a3a2da86888268e0459fa5179c725c94e880fdae0c722054a89:0
- value
- 68843394
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d65f167ed6eed42a4af0b3613eeb21605791e28e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LYVWsdb9cCJFnV8tZ2U5i6VR8kNKpZ7xk